Understanding Connector Apps
Connector apps are essentially software applications designed to facilitate communication between two or more software platforms that would not typically be able to share data or functionality directly. These connectors act as a bridge, enabling disparate systems to interact with each other by translating messages, automating workflows, and synchronising data in real time.
The primary goal of connector apps is to streamline processes, reduce manual tasks, and ensure that various applications within an ecosystem can exchange information seamlessly.

Key Features of Connector Apps
- Data Synchronisation: They synchronise data across different platforms, ensuring that information is up-to-date across all systems.
- Workflow Automation: By automating routine tasks, they save time and reduce errors caused by manual data entry.
- Customisation: Many connector apps offer customisable options to fit specific business needs, allowing for tailored integrations.
- Scalability: They can scale with your business, handling increased loads as your operations grow.
When to Use Connector Apps
Connector apps come into play in various scenarios across industries. Here are some common situations when using a connector app becomes pivotal:
Integrating Disparate Systems
When businesses use multiple software solutions for different functions - such as CRM systems for sales activities, ERP systems for resource planning, and eCommerce platforms for online sales - connector apps can integrate these systems for smoother operations.
Automating Business Processes
For repetitive tasks like order processing, inventory updates, or customer data management across platforms, connector apps can automate these processes, reducing the need for manual intervention.
Enhancing Data Analytics
When you need consolidated data from multiple sources for comprehensive analytics and reporting purposes, connector apps can facilitate this integration, providing a unified view of information.
Scaling Operations
As businesses grow and adopt more specialised software solutions, maintaining seamless communication among these tools becomes challenging. Connector apps enable scalability by ensuring new and existing systems work together efficiently.
Choosing the Right Connector App
Selecting the appropriate connector app depends on several factors including compatibility with existing systems, customisation capabilities, ease of use, support provided by the vendor, and cost. It's important to assess your specific integration needs and evaluate potential connector apps against these criteria. For example, a retail company might use a connector app like Zapier to automate data transfer between their CRM and email marketing services, significantly speeding up customer communications and improving campaign responsiveness. Another instance could be a manufacturing firm utilising MuleSoft to integrate their ERP and supply chain management systems, ensuring real-time updates across the board and reducing inventory errors. Additionally, consider the security features of the app. Given that sensitive data will likely be shared between systems via the connector app, robust security measures are paramount to protect against data breaches and ensure compliance with relevant regulations.
